A delegation of eight Samajwadi Party MPs will reach Rampur on July 25 in connection with the Johar University case in Rampur, Uttar Pradesh. Here he will meet the local officials and appeal to stop the demolition and will also hold a press conference. In this regard, state party president Shyam Lal Pal has issued a letter today giving information.
The delegation will include Rampur District President Ajay Sagar along with Rajya Sabha MP Javed Ali, Lok Sabha MP Harendra Malik, Ruchi Veera, Iqra Hasan, Rajiv Rai, Mohibullah, Neeraj Maurya and Zia Ur Rehman Burke.
RDA has given notice to demolish 38 buildings
Let us tell you here that Rampur Development Authority has given notice to Rampur-based Johar University to demolish 38 buildings. According to him, these buildings have been built without rules and standards. The matter has heated up after the notice of July 15. The university management has also filed an appeal in the Commissioner’s Court against this notice and has alleged that there is a conspiracy to demolish the educational institution.
SP is completely united on this issue and is accusing Rampur Administration along with Rampur Development Authority of taking unilateral action. For the past several days, party MLAs and other leaders have started gathering in Rampur. Today, Leader of Opposition Mata Prasad Pandey also reached Rampur and assessed the situation.
Protest continues outside the university
On the other hand, after the order of the authority, the teachers and students of the university are sitting on protest. He has appealed to the administration not to demolish the university. SP MLAs are also reaching continuously. SP leaders and management have also announced to take this matter to court. He claims that he has all the evidence in which the construction in the university was done after the entire process was completed. At present, politics is very hot in this matter.
